Tomorrow is my birthday!   I will be achieving my 56th year.   Holy guacamole!  I keep checking my to make sure the year I was born is correct, 1957?    I have been very aware of my age and my attitude was starting to reflect it.   From upbeat, crazy songs floating through my head maintaining my youth, I began humming “Volga Boat Men”.  Just a couple days ago, the manager of the movie theater charged me the senior rate, WITHOUT ME EVEN ASKING!    Mandatory retirement creeping up on me, thinking of taking more naps and just general crabbiness.    Actually scared myself when I looked in the mirror and thought an old man had snuck  into my bathroom and was staring back at me from the mirror.

OK, so a few years have floated by.   Life has certainly provided some serious challenges and of course, that  old man looking back at me is me.   So what is wrong with getting cheaper movie tickets?   Or getting 15% off Zingerman’s warehouse store on Monday’s?  (senior’s day)  How about those incredible memories and experiences?    My wonderful family?   My fantastic friends and co-workers?   I still can have a pretty good work out, have plenty of energy to work outside and even to enjoy cocktails on the deck looking at a beautiful sunset.

So this morning and perhaps all this week, the song going through my head will be “Young at Heart”.  That wonderful Frank Sinatra song.   I would like to think that is me and my attitude.
